SMT Spring Contacts

Harwin SMT Spring Contacts allow for flexibility when creating electrical and grounding connections. With many configurations and working heights, these spring contacts provide an ideal solution when space constraints are an issue. They are ideal for blind mating and tolerant to both wiping and sliding actions. The contacts are provided on tape and reel for automated assembly and cost-effective production. Harwin SMT Spring Contacts are available in a variety of configurations to provide an array of benefits. Antenna contacts with a positive stop feature prevent overstressing and permanent set of the component. Multidirectional contacts allow for vertical or horizontal use. The box style design prevents twists and snagging of the free end, while C-shape designs allow for simple and effective contact with metal shields or frames.

EMC Shielding Solutions

Harwin EMC Shielding Solutions include a range of surface-mount shield clips, compatible shield cans, and spring contacts to solve a variety of EMI/RFI and grounding issues. The SMT components are provided on tape and reel for automated assembly and lowered production costs. Shield cans and clips eliminate the need for manual soldering, simplifying production and increasing reliability. Harwin spring contacts prevent RFI noise and allow for design flexibility when an electrical or grounding connection is needed.

Harwin EZ-Shield Fingers

Harwin RFI Shield Fingers can be assembled to PCBs and used as grounding or shielding contacts, in contact with metal frames or shields. Suitable for both wiping and sliding action, the individual clips are ideal for automated placement.
